Milliken offers clarifiers and nucleators to improve polypropylene (PP) resins, UV absorbers that improve key properties in PET packaging, and colorants for use with high- performance engineering polymers. Milliken’s Millad NX 8000 is the clarifying agent used to produce UltraClear PP resin, which then can be processed to yield clarity and transparency in injection molded, blow molded and thermoformed polypropylene products. It also enables low-temperature processing in injection molding when compared to PP clarified with traditional clarifiers, which in turn yields both faster cycle times and energy savings. of pigments. This means that molders can achieve high part quality regardless of the color used. Milliken’s ClearShield UV absorber can


improve key properties in PET packaging. It effectively protects UV-sensitive packed contents from ultraviolet-light degradation while maintaining the clarity and transparency of PET. Makers of home and personal care products increasingly are


using more natural ingredients, and they’re embracing memorable colors, active ingredients and special additives. But UV light can negatively impact some of these new ingredients, and current UV filters come with their own challenges. The crystal-clear ClearShield additive is compounded directly into the PET resin, which eliminates the need to add UV additives to the formulations of the packaged contents themselves. Finally, Milliken’s Keyplast range of dyes


and pigments for plastics can be used by liquid and solid masterbatch producers and compounders. These colorants yield a vast spectrum of stable, reproducible colors, and are suitable for use with a wide range of resins — from PET in transparent food- contact applications, and polystyrene in most general-purpose, medium and high- impact grades; to polycarbonate offering excellent clarity and compatibility with high processing temperatures, and nylon in most compounds of nylon 6, nylon 6,6, glass-filled compounds, and other polyamide resins.
